Antonio Conte comes to Napoli: the Italian manager signs a three-year contract to return to Serie A until 2027

The Serie A coaching that has been rumored for months is finally official. Antonio Conte is the new head coach of Napoli. The Italian manager returns to Italy to coach a Serie A team after his experience in the Premier League at Tottenham Hotspur, signing a three-year contract until the summer of 2027 with Aurelio De Laurentiis’ club. After a disappointing season, Napoli is starting a new chapter under Conte, who returns to the Italian Serie A three years after his departure.

Conte praised his new club in a statement.

“Napoli is a place of global importance. I am happy and excited at the idea of ​​being on the Azzurri bench. I can certainly promise one thing: I will do my utmost for the growth of the team and the club. My commitment, together with that of my staff, will be total.”

After starting his coaching career at Arezzo, Siena and Bari, Juventus appointed Conte in the summer of 2011, where he returned the club to winning the Scudetto for the first time since the Calciopoli scandal in 2006. In the summer of 2014, Conte resigned from the club. the job and became coach of the Italian national team, leading the Azzurri to the quarter-finals of UEFA Euro 2016.

In the same summer, the Italian coach joined Chelsea, where he won the Premier League title in his first year in charge, but was sacked at the end of his second season despite winning the FA Cup thanks to a difficult relationship with club owner Roman Abrahmovic. In 2019, he made his comeback to Italian football after Inter decided to appoint him, and won the Scudetto in his second season, but then resigned again as the club was forced to sell two key players from its squad in Romelu Lukaku . and Achraf Hakimi due to financial problems. Former Juventus sporting director Fabio Paratici convinced Conte to join Tottenham in November 2021, and after a strong start to his Spurs experience, taking Spurs to a top-four finish and qualifying for the Champions League, the two teams will split up in March 2023.

Conte is now ready to be back and De Laurentiis decided to appoint him and his backroom staff to return the club to glory after Napoli failed to qualify for European competitions and finished tenth just one year after winning a historic Scudetto in the Italian league. Napoli, after parting ways with Luciano Spalletti in the summer of 2023, appointed three managers last season (Rudi Garcia, Walter Mazzarri and Francesco Calzona), but none of them could rediscover the magic that the club had during the previous season .
